What's Happening?
Netflix has officially renewed Wednesday for a third season, set to delve into darker and more mysterious themes. Co-creators Alfred Gough and Miles Millar have indicated that the upcoming season will expand the lore of Nevermore Academy, introducing stranger and sharper mysteries. Jenna Ortega, who teased horror references earlier this year, will return as an executive producer, signaling a creative shift in the series' tone. The renewal was announced on July 23, 2025, shortly before the conclusion of Part 2, reflecting Netflix's confidence in the show's direction.

What's Next?
Filming for Wednesday Season 3 is set to begin on November 30, 2026, in Wicklow. Fans can expect teaser drops and creator interviews to provide further insights into the horror elements and new antagonists tied to Nevermore's lineage.
